Copper downspout installation involves fitting high-quality copper pipes to the edges of a roof to direct rainwater away from a property’s foundation. This service typically includes measuring, cutting, and securely attaching copper downspouts to existing gutter systems or installing new systems from scratch. Skilled contractors ensure that the downspouts are properly aligned and sealed to prevent leaks, helping to maintain the integrity of the property’s exterior and reduce potential water damage.

This service addresses common problems such as water pooling around the foundation, basement flooding, and erosion of landscaping caused by improperly directed rainwater. Copper downspouts are especially effective in preventing these issues because they provide a durable and reliable channel for runoff. Proper installation also helps avoid issues like rust or corrosion that can occur with other materials, ensuring the system remains functional and visually appealing over time.

Properties that typically benefit from copper downspout installation include residential homes, especially those with unique architectural features or historic designs that call for a more refined look. Additionally, commercial buildings and properties with extensive roofing systems may require robust drainage solutions to handle larger volumes of water efficiently. Copper’s aesthetic appeal and longevity make it a popular choice for homeowners and property managers seeking a combination of durability and visual enhancement.

The overview below groups typical Copper Downspout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Coeur D Alene, ID.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or downspout repairs or replacements range from $150 to $400.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for localized fixes or minor upgrades. Larger or more complex repairs can sometimes reach up to $600.

Full Downspout Replacement - Replacing entire sections or the full downspout system usually costs between $500 and $1,200. Most projects in this category are straightforward and stay within this range, though more elaborate installations can go higher.

Custom or Extended Installations - Custom or longer downspout systems, especially those requiring additional components, typically range from $1,200 to $3,000. These projects are less common but are necessary for larger or more complex setups.

Complex or Large-Scale Projects - Larger, more intricate downspout installations or extensive gutter system upgrades can exceed $3,000, with some reaching $5,000 or more. These are less frequent but represent the upper end of typical costs for comprehensive work in the Coeur D Alene area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of choosing copper downspouts? Copper downspouts are known for their durability and classic appearance, which can enhance the curb appeal of a property in Coeur D Alene, ID. Local contractors can provide options that match the style and architecture of nearby homes.

How do copper downspouts compare to other materials? Copper downspouts typically last longer and develop a unique patina over time, offering a low-maintenance solution. Local service providers can help determine if copper is suitable for specific property needs.

Can copper downspouts be customized to fit different roof styles? Yes, local contractors can customize copper downspouts to fit various roof configurations and property designs, ensuring proper drainage and a seamless look.

What is involved in the installation process for copper downspouts? The installation usually includes measuring, fitting, and attaching the copper components securely to ensure effective water runoff. Local pros handle the installation to match existing gutter systems.

Are copper downspouts suitable for all types of buildings? Copper downspouts are versatile and can be installed on residential, commercial, or historic properties in Coeur D Alene, ID, depending on the building’s style and drainage requirements.
